    My Lehman's wheels have a wheel manufacturer's clear coating over aluminum and painted surfaces. just wipe with wax.

    I have striped two sets of rubber like coated (like epoxy paint?) Ford wheels back to bare aluminum using stripper, sander, spinning wheel on car bare, then wet or dry fine sandpaper, then polishing … and once polished with a polish intended for aluminum, just lightly detail polish maybe once a year and those wheels look good and sit in the driveway. Getting them smoothly polished makes it easier to maintain a sparkly look. I've tried clear coatings, but if scratched or any gets peeled, one has to remove coating to make it look good again, in my experience.

    I learned to polish on older Brit bikes.

    I have always used DuPont #7 rubbing compound for stain/pit removal and then semichrome polish for shine.... It takes a while on the first treatment (hours) but then you have permanent shine. Something in the two compounds acts like a way in that I have never had aluminum that I polished revert to the pitting that it exhibited pre-polishing. But be warned.... it is a bear to get the initial polish to a luster that you will like. somethings 1200 grit sandpaper is needed for the first phase to get the scratches and mill marks out. But I guarantee a product that will please once you do it.

    I ride all winter here in Chicago so I need something for my wheels. I have been using S100 Corrosion Protectant for over 10 years. A couple years ago I tried the new H-D bare aluminum product. It completely ruined my wheels. Since then I use the OEM wheels as my winter wheels (they're already ruined) and bought a set of H-D Anarchy chrome wheels as my summer wheels. Problem solved. Windex is all I use now to clean the chrome wheels.

    I would highly recommend S100 CP if just starting out with a new bike. I would polish the wheels and then spray on the S100 and buff it out.

    Don't understand why anyone would sell a car/bike with untreated aluminum wheels in the snow belt. They have to be morons.
